摘  要:The chromosome specimens of Epinephelus malabaricus (Bloch & Schneider, 1801) are obtained from metaphase of kindney cell by vivi-injection of PHA and culture of colchicines, hypatoic-air drying technique, and then by studying their Giemsa stain, C-bands and AgNORs. The results are as follows: (1)E. malabaricus has a diploid chromosome number of 48 and its karyotype formula is 48t, NF=48, sex chromosome is not found. (2) There is a pair of chromosomes with secondary constriction near the centromere of chromosome t24. (3) 1~4 nucleoli appear in the nucleus of interphase, 55% nuclei has 1 nucleolus and only 2% for 4 nucleoli. (4) AgNORs appear in the chromosome t24 of 50% metaphase, sometimes in the chromosome t5, but not in other chromosomes. (5) The AgNORs polymorphisms are individually specific, 1~4 pairs of the number, and the frequency of 4 AgNORs are lowest. (6) The secondary constrictions and positive C-bands are coincident, close to the centromere of the chromosome, and mass constrictive heterochromatins appear in that region. (7) All the centromeres of chromosomes are darkly stained C-bands, and the whole arm of chromosome t24 and its centromere are same positive C-bands. (8) The evolutive regulation of the karyotype and the developing mechanism of AgNORs and C-bands are discussed.
